Q: Is 4,625,768 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,625,768 is a composite number.

Why is 4,625,768 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,625,768 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 8 14 17 28 34 43 56 68 86 113 119 136 172 226 238 301 344 452 476 602 731 791 904 952 1,204 1,462 1,582 1,921 2,408 2,924 3,164 3,842 4,859 5,117 5,848 6,328 7,684 9,718 10,234 13,447 15,368 19,436 20,468 26,894 34,013 38,872 40,936 53,788 68,026 82,603 107,576 136,052 165,206 272,104 330,412 578,221 660,824 1,156,442 2,312,884 and 4,625,768, with no remainder.

Since 4,625,768 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,625,768, it is a composite number.
